是否有可能在iOS 11中以编程方式获取正在运行/已安装的应用程序列表。如果有人知道答案,请帮助我。我搜索了很多网站以寻求答案,其中大多数显示它是不可能的。请帮助我< / p>
答案 0 :(得分:0)
您可以使用AppList库获取所有已安装应用的列表。 它使用私有框架,因此它也只是越狱。请查看https://github.com/rpetrich/AppList。
OR
您还可以阅读/ Applications文件夹。所有已安装的应用程序都可用。您需要使用NSFileManager列出/ Applications中的目录:
NSArray * appFolderContents = [[NSFileManager defaultManager] directoryContentsAtPath:@“/ Applications”];
答案 1 :(得分:0)
好的,你不能得到所有的应用程序,但你可以用不同的方式完成你的任务。 App Store上有一款名为Carat的应用程序,它列出了消耗电池的应用程序。这是该应用程序的GitHub链接
也许它会对你有所帮助